Every institutional buyer of an on-chain investment product asks the same operational questions before allocating. Today, they piece together answers from audit PDFs, docs pages, oracle feeds, and email chains with issuers' investor relations teams. No standardized artifact exists. No continuous verification exists. No procurement-grade evidence layer exists.
Plinth's five-pillar framework was benchmarked against published research and diligence methodologies from leading RWA, institutional and crypto-native research organizations, including RWA.xyz, Galaxy Research, Coinbase Institutional, a16z crypto, Messari, Delphi Digital, S&P Global Ratings, Moody's Ratings, LlamaRisk and Particula. The review was repeated independently across multiple AI models to reduce model-specific bias and test consistency of the mapping. While terminology differs across firms, the substantive questions consistently cluster around control, assets, economics, governance and compliance, and continuity.
Plinth is aggregated trust infrastructure. Issuers of on-chain investment products use it to publish a single, standardized trust center under their own domain. Every source keeps its authorship and derivation visible so institutional buyers know exactly what they are relying on.
The current OUSG worked example is a frozen, reproducible public-data baseline. The intended workflow adds monitoring, procurement exports, and customer-controlled AI use without blurring the evidence boundary.
Trust standards work when they are structurally independent from the parties they measure. Plinth is designed for exactly that role in on-chain investment products. Infrastructure any issuer can adopt, on any platform, verified by methodology that anyone can reproduce.
